Multiple Chemical Sensitivity on The Health Report

Monday 5 May 2008

ABC Radio NationalNorman Swan of ABC Radio National’s The Health Report has not been notably empathetic with our movement. But here he interviews Professor Gail McKeown-Eyssen, a Canadian cancer researcher who has found out interesting things about the body’s pathways for people with MCS. And Swan sounds as if perhaps he can see that MCS is not just “all in the mind”!
